After the translation to the right by 4 units and up by 1 unit, the coordinates of A′, B′ and C′ are:
First, list the coordinates for the original points:
A translation to the right means that it will be added to the x coordinates and a translation up means that it will be added to the y coordinates.
The coordinates to the new points are:
A:
= (-6 + 4), (5 + 1)
= (-2, 6)
B:
= (3 + 4), (2 + 1)
= (7, 3)
C:
= (0 + 4), (-1 + 1)
= (4, 0)
